I know I have all the busbars. I only need a diagram of where each BMS wire needs to be connected after I connect all busbars
 
First, disconnect the plug with all the wires from the BMS both black leads the large one and the small one will connect to the negative post of the battery then on the next cell positive post connect the first red wire next to the black lead on the plug then the next red wire the next positive post and so on until all wires are connected (cell is two cells connected in parallel to act as one cell). after you are connected using a voltmeter with the negative lead connected to the black lead test the voltage on the plug to make sure the wires are connected correctly test each pin on the plug to make sure the voltage goes up as you move down the line if the voltage goes down you do not have them correct and need to retrace your connections.
